Radeon R7 360 vs Radeon Pro WX 3200 specs and performance
For gaming, the Radeon Pro WX 3200 graphics card is better than the Radeon R7 360 in our tests.
Our database shows that the Radeon Pro WX 3200 has a slightly higher core clock speed. This is the frequency at which the graphics core is running at. While not necessarily an indicator of overall performance, this metric can be useful when comparing two GPUs based on the same architecture.
Furthermore, the spec sheet for both these GPUs show that the Radeon Pro WX 3200 has significantly more memory with 4 GiB of memory compared to 2 GiB. Memory size doesn't directly affect performance, but too little memory will certainly degrade gaming performance.
In addition, the Radeon Pro WX 3200 has a significantly lower TDP at 65 W when compared to the Radeon R7 360 at 100 W. This is not a measure of performance, but rather the amount of heat generated by the chip when running at its highest speed.
In terms of raw gaming performance in our GPU benchmark, the Radeon Pro WX 3200 is better than the Radeon R7 360.
